If the epoxy stinks its probably bad. It should have a chemical odor that is not very strong, not a smell that will drive you out of the room just by opening the bottle for a few seconds.

I've used a LOT of epoxy and never had any old enough that it smelled that bad, but I have heard of it. Usually when my epoxy's hardener starts to yellow (about 6 months to 1 year old) I quit using that batch for structure and just use it for fuelproofing firewalls. When it starts to be thicker (another 6 months) I toss it.

*********

I have had 2 hour epoxy that took up to 2 days to quit being tacky... (generally find that I didn;t use as much hardener as i should have when that happens.) I've never had good 5 min or 30 min epoxy that failed to be hard within the list time or double. I've had it set faster (10 min and it was a rock with 30 min epoxy) when mixing a large batch in a warm room.

Never had a problem with Tower brand stuff... I am using some of thier 15 min, 30 min and 2 hour stuff on a plane now.

If the epoxy is cold before mixing it will set up slower, I just use my heat gun to wam the bottle a little until it flows good, then I mix the two and it will set in normal times and dry, tack free in double the stated set-up time. When ever you use an evaporative thinner, it will slow dry times because you loose too much heat while the stuff evaporates. Heating epoxy after it's mixed doesn't really speed up curing for some strange reason.
